Top 5 Perp DEXes on Sui Network

Perpetual DEX trading volume hit a record $1.3 trillion globally in October 2025, a figure that nearly doubled from the previous month and cemented these platforms as a core driver in the current crypto cycle, where derivatives trading outpaces spot markets by a wide margin.

As volatility persists and institutional interest grows, perp DEXes have become essential tools for hedging and speculation. A perp DEX operates by letting users trade perpetual futures contracts, which track an asset’s price without expiring. Traders open long or short positions with leverage, often up to 50x or more, while funding rates—periodic payments between longs and shorts—keep the contract price aligned with the spot price. Liquidity providers supply capital to pools that facilitate these trades, earning fees in return.

On the SUI network, known for its parallel processing and sub-second finality, these DEXes handle high volumes efficiently, reducing slippage and gas costs compared to congested chains. This setup supports complex strategies, from simple bets on price direction to advanced yield farming tied to perps. With SUI’s perp volume reaching $113.5 million in a recent 24-hour period and overall DEX activity sustaining around $456 million daily for quarters on end, the ecosystem shows robust growth. Below, explore the top five perp DEXes on SUI, each bringing distinct mechanisms to enhance trading depth and user experience.

1. Bluefin

Bluefin is a leader in SUI’s perp landscape, handling over 90% of the network’s perpetual futures volume through its robust infrastructure. Built with a focus on institutional-grade performance, it offers deep liquidity—averaging $4 million within a 1% price deviation for major pairs—and spreads tighter than 1 basis point, which minimizes costs for high-frequency traders.

The platform integrates spot and perps trading seamlessly, allowing users to execute dollar-cost averaging orders via an intuitive slider interface that adjusts entry points over time. Recent upgrades include enhanced risk engines that adapt to market stress, ensuring stable orderbook displays even during network switches or tab backgrounding.

Beyond basic trading, Bluefin extends into lending and vaults, where users can supply assets to earn yields while curators manage strategies through multi-party computation wallets for added security. For instance, its partnership with Ember Protocol enables strategy vaults that generate new yield opportunities, such as stablecoin deposits yielding over 50% APY for holders of its eBLUE token.

A strategic lending agreement with SUI Group, a NASDAQ-listed entity, injects capital to accelerate on-chain structured products, bridging traditional finance with SUI’s composability. Traders benefit from transparent earnings tracking, with yield analytics now live on DeFiLlama, and features like position history charts that plot cumulative profit and loss. This combination makes Bluefin a comprehensive hub, where a single interface supports everything from speculative perps to passive income generation, all settled on-chain with SUI’s low latency.

2. Zof AI Perps

Zof AI Perps differentiates itself by embedding artificial intelligence directly into the trading process, delivering zero-slippage executions that rival centralized exchanges while remaining fully on-chain. The platform achieves instant fills without price impact through balanced liquidity provider pools, which dynamically adjust to protect capital and distribute risks evenly across participants. Users earn real yields from trading fees, creating a sustainable model where activity directly benefits liquidity suppliers.

What sets Zof apart is its AI-powered agents: these tools act as automated traders and advisors, analyzing market data in real-time to suggest positions or execute strategies based on user-defined parameters, such as risk tolerance or target returns. For example, an agent might monitor funding rates and automatically adjust leverage to optimize for positive carry trades.

Built natively on SUI, Zof leverages the network’s composability, allowing seamless integration with other protocols for layered strategies—like combining perps with lending for amplified yields. The CEX-grade performance comes from optimized smart contracts that minimize gas usage, ensuring trades process in under a second even during peak volatility. This approach not only appeals to retail traders seeking hassle-free entries but also to developers building composable apps, as Zof’s modules can be plugged into broader DeFi ecosystems. Overall, it provides a high-speed, protective environment where AI enhances decision-making without compromising decentralization.

3. Astros AG

Astros AG fuses perpetual trading with lending, creating a self-sustaining ecosystem that draws from over $1 billion in capital from NAVI Protocol, SUI’s leading lending platform. This integration forms a reinforcing loop: trading activity generates yields for lenders, who in turn provide deeper liquidity, leading to tighter spreads and better execution for traders.

Launched recently, Astros quickly surpassed $100 million in trading volume within its first week, showcasing strong initial adoption driven by its native SUI design. Users open positions on majors like BTC or ETH perps, with leverage supported by borrowed assets that flow directly into the DEX’s pools. The platform’s architecture ensures that increased volume boosts lender returns, encouraging more deposits and thus more robust markets— a cycle that has helped it scale rapidly.

Features include verifiable on-chain settlements, where every match is transparent and auditable, reducing counterparty risks common in off-chain models. Astros also emphasizes capital efficiency, allowing lenders to earn competitive APYs while traders access low-fee perps with minimal slippage.

By tying perps to lending, it addresses liquidity fragmentation on SUI, pooling resources for smoother operations. This model suits users who value interconnected DeFi primitives, as positions can be collateralized against borrowed funds, enabling strategies like leveraged yield farming without leaving the platform.

4. Aftermath Fi

Aftermath Fi pioneers fully on-chain orderbook trading for perps, eliminating off-chain matching to deliver unmatched transparency and verifiability. On SUI, where low latency and unique gas models enable this feat, Aftermath processes orders entirely on the blockchain, a first for perp DEXes that traditionally rely on hybrid systems. Traders place limit or market orders on an orderbook interface, with settlements happening in real-time and every step recorded immutably. This setup appeals to those wary of opacity in centralized venues, as users can audit matches and executions directly.

Recent partnerships, such as with Bolt Liquidity, introduce zero-slippage swaps for spot assets that feed into perps, enhancing entry and exit efficiency. The platform also includes staking and farming options, where liquidity providers earn from fees and incentives, with APRs often in triple digits for select pools.

For instance, users can farm tokens like IKA while providing liquidity for perps, combining speculation with passive rewards. Aftermath’s MEV infrastructure protects against front-running, ensuring fair pricing. Its road to mainnet has focused on security, with audits emphasizing robust risk management for leveraged positions. This makes it ideal for advanced traders who prioritize control and auditability, all while benefiting from SUI’s speed for high-throughput trading.

5. FlowX Finance Perpetual

FlowX Finance serves as the aggregator layer for SUI’s perp ecosystem, connecting users to liquidity across multiple markets for optimized executions. Rather than building isolated pools, it routes trades through major perp providers, aggregating depth to offer low spreads and fast fills in a single interface.

This one-stop access simplifies navigation, especially for newcomers, by scanning protocols like those above and selecting the best path based on price, slippage, and fees. FlowX’s perpetual module supports up to 3x leverage on isolated margin, with recent additions like pre-token trading for assets such as AERO before official launches.

Built on Hyperliquid-inspired mechanics, it emphasizes capital efficiency, allowing shorts or longs on a wide range of pairs with minimal collateral requirements. Users toggle between classic swaps and perps seamlessly, and integrations like the SDK enable other DEXes to embed its aggregator for better rates.

For example, its partnership with SuiRewards.Me lets users access FlowX-powered trades within that interface. The platform also verifies new tokens quickly, ensuring safe entry into emerging markets. This aggregator approach reduces fragmentation on SUI, where diverse perps can lead to scattered liquidity, making FlowX a practical choice for traders seeking convenience without sacrificing performance.

These platforms collectively demonstrate SUI’s strengths in handling sophisticated derivatives, with total perp volume on the network reflecting steady expansion amid broader market trends. Whether through AI enhancements, lending integrations, or aggregation, they provide tools for diverse strategies, supported by the chain’s technical edge.
